Package "Primary diagnosis of allergy"
This diagnostic panel is intended for the initial examination of patients with allergy-like symptoms when a more detailed analysis is needed. Suitable for both children and adults.
The package includes 50 clinically significant allergens, covering key groups: pollen, household, epidermal, and food allergens.
Testing is performed using the ImmunoCAP method, recognized as the gold standard in laboratory allergy diagnostics, ensuring high sensitivity, specificity, and reproducibility of results.
Package Composition:
Allergen panels are selected based on clinical relevance:
Pollen Allergens:
- Grass mix (gx2): Bermuda grass, ryegrass, timothy grass, meadow grass, sorghum, buckwheat
- Tree mix (tx9): alder, birch, hazel, oak, willow
- Weed mix (wx1): ragweed, mugwort, plantain, goosefoot, Russian thistle
Lamb's quarters (w15)
Household Allergens:
- House dust mix (hx2): Dermatophagoides pteronyssinus, D. farinae, cockroach, mold (Hollister-Stier)
- Mold mix (mx2): Alternaria alternata, Cladosporium herbarum, Aspergillus fumigatus, Penicillium chrysogenum, Candida albicans, Setomelanomma rostrata
Epidermal Allergens:
- Ex1 mix: dander of cat, dog, horse, cow
Food Allergens:
- fx5 mix: milk, egg, fish, wheat, peanut, soy
- fx15 mix: orange, banana, apple, peach
- fx1 mix: peanut, hazelnut, almond, coconut, Brazil nut
- fx13 mix: carrot, potato, white bean, green pea
